NORTHUMBERLAND MP has said she will continue to make the argument for upgrades to a notorious roundabout until the Government makes its decision.

- JAMES ROBINSON Local democracy reporter

Ministers are considering whether or not to give the green light to long-awaited plans to upgrade Moor Farm Roundabout near Cramlington.

The town's Labour and Coop MP Emma Foody has secured parliamentary debates on the issue twice this year, and insists she will continue to lobby ministers until the plans are approved.

Speaking to The Journal after the latest debate, Ms Foody stressed the importance of the project to the North East.

She said: "These are upgrades that our area and our region needs. Decisions won't get made until the first part of next year - between now and then, it's just continuing to make the case to transport ministers and across the board.

"It's a roundabout that nobody enjoys going on. People fear the unreliability and not knowing what the traffic is going to be like it causes day-to-day misery.
